The updates aren't always the fault of the hardware vendor.

Sometimes the underlying code or standards are updated or deprecated (as in the case of SSL).

With devices that have to inter-operate with devices from multiple vendors, sometimes you have to build in safeguards to prevent problems caused by carelessness and/or hubris on the part of a third party.

I think we'd all prefer that the vendor make provisions rather than declare everything else to be broken.

Since I will essentially have two routers working, I should probably exclude the two IP addresses on the Netgear from assigning on the Linksys.
 
I would set the new netgear up as 192.168.10.1 so that the DHCP pool starts with 192.168.10.2 up to 192.168.10.254.
Assuming your current Linksys is set to 192.168.1.1 and DHCP pools has 192.168.1.2 up to 192.168.1.254 ...
If you leave the netgear alone, it'll be the same as the linksys most likely, and you might have conflicting IP addresses.
All you gotta do is change the netgear from DHCP to static ..see the following.
This is a TPLINK that's connected to my 192.168.1.1 netgear...and I chose 1.9 for the IP address, while using 0.1 as the DHCP pool for this router. Your netgear should be similar to this:
